エグゼクティブサマリー
EnclaveProtocol は、ゼロ知識証明(Zero-Knowledge Proof, ZKP)技術に基づく分散型プライバシー保護プロトコルであり、ブロックチェーンエコシステムに強化されたプライバシー保護機能を提供することを目的としています。革新的な暗号学的構造と分散システム設計を通じて、このプロトコルは完全に分散化された環境で取引プロセスのプライバシー化、デジタル資産のプライバシー化、オンチェーン資産管理のプライバシー化という 3 つの次元でのプライバシー保護を実現し、Web3 エコシステムに完全なプライバシー保護ソリューションを提供します。
本研究は、新しいプライバシー保護資産配分メカニズムを提案しています。Deposit ID バインディング技術とマルチバウチャー(Multi-Voucher)アーキテクチャを通じて、既存のプライバシー決済システムの非固定額面シナリオでの技術的制限を解決し、完全な分散化を維持しながら強力なプライバシー保護を提供するという目標を達成しています。
コアバリュー提案:ブロックチェーンのプライバシー機能強化
EnclaveProtocol は、ゼロ知識証明技術を通じて、ブロックチェーンネットワークに 3 つの次元でのプライバシー保護機能強化を提供します:
1. 取引プロセスのプライバシー化(Transaction Process Privacy)
このプロトコルは、取引プロセスの完全なプライバシーを実現し、以下を含みます:
- 匿名性保証(Anonymity Guarantee): ゼロ知識証明技術を通じて、送信者、受信者、取引金額情報の完全な隠蔽を実現し、強匿名性(Strong Anonymity)要件を満たします
- 関係プライバシー保護(Relationship Privacy Protection): 取引当事者間には追跡可能なオンチェーン関連が存在せず、関係プライバシー(Relationship Privacy)保護を実現します
- バッチプライバシー操作(Batch Privacy Operations): 一対多のプライバシー配分メカニズムをサポートし、複数の受信者が互いの存在を知らない状態で、受信者分離(Recipient Isolation)を実現します
- 分散型検証(Decentralized Verification): 純粋なオンチェーンゼロ知識証明検証メカニズムを使用し、集中型コンポーネントを必要とせず、分散化(Decentralization)要件を満たします
2. デジタル資産のプライバシー化(Digital Asset Privacy)
このプロトコルは、デジタル資産のプライバシー保護を実現し、以下を含みます:
- 資産起源プライバシー(Asset Origin Privacy): 暗号学的メカニズムを通じて資産の元の起源と転送パスを隠し、オンチェーンの追跡と分析を防止します
- 資産保有プライバシー(Asset Holding Privacy): ユーザーの資産保有状況が公開されないように保護し、富分析(Wealth Analysis)攻撃を防止します
- 資産配分プライバシー(Asset Allocation Privacy): 柔軟な資産分割と配分メカニズムをサポートし、各配分バウチャーを独立して管理し、配分プライバシー(Allocation Privacy)を実現します
- クロスチェーン資産プライバシー(Cross-Chain Asset Privacy): マルチチェーン展開アーキテクチャをサポートし、クロスチェーン資産のプライバシー保護を実現し、クロスチェーン相関分析(Cross-Chain Correlation Analysis)を防止します
3. オンチェーン資産管理のプライバシー化(On-Chain Wealth Management Privacy)
このプロトコルは、オンチェーン資産管理のプライバシーを実現し、以下を含みます:
- 富分布プライバシー(Wealth Distribution Privacy): ユーザーの異なるチェーン上の富分布を保護し、グローバル富分析(Global Wealth Analysis)を防止します
- ポートフォリオプライバシー(Portfolio Privacy): プライバシー保護型の資産配分とポートフォリオ管理をサポートし、投資戦略情報を保護します
- 収益配分プライバシー(Revenue Distribution Privacy): 企業、DAO、プロジェクトが複数の受信者にプライベートに収益を配分でき、配分戦略を保護します
- 資金流動プライバシー(Fund Flow Privacy): 資金流動情報を保護し、オンチェーン分析と追跡を防止し、流動プライバシー(Flow Privacy)を実現します
技術的貢献
本研究は、プライバシー決済分野で以下の技術的ブレークスルーを達成しました:
Deposit ID バインディングメカニズム(Deposit ID Binding Mechanism): 資金アンカーと配分証明を分離する新しいメカニズムを提案し、非固定額面シナリオでの二重支払い防止(Double-Spending Prevention)問題を解決し、完全に分散化されたプライバシー取引を実現しました
マルチバウチャーアーキテクチャ(Multi-Voucher Architecture): 単一預金の柔軟な分割と独立管理を可能にするマルチバウチャー(Multi-Voucher)技術を設計し、複雑な資産管理シナリオをサポートしながら、暗号学的セキュリティを維持します
独立 Nullifier メカニズム(Independent Nullifier Mechanism): 各バウチャーは独立した nullifier を持ち、暗号学的ハッシュ関数を通じて一意性と偽造不可能性を確保し、二重支払い防止(Anti-Double-Spending)要件を満たします
三重プライバシー保護アーキテクチャ(Triple Privacy Protection Architecture): 取引プライバシー、資産プライバシー、資産管理プライバシーの完全なソリューションを構築し、多次元プライバシー保護を実現しました
知的財産権に関する声明
EnclaveProtocol はオープンソースライセンスを使用していますが、コア技術は特許によって保護されています。商業展開(法定通貨のやり取りや暗号通貨トークンを含むシステム)には、特許所有者からの明示的な承認が必要です。詳細については、付録 C を参照してください。